Output 44c9581750cf3f167c1c4f8a6ae71c477dea907eb7dd373eacd33b4186ba9358:32

value
60404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d653b2a7d72f4e466defe3492f6ba29a6150e313 OP_EQUAL
address
3MEGo2SbwfiksaA9mrdT2rCXL6wZTboQhh
transaction
44c9581750cf3f167c1c4f8a6ae71c477dea907eb7dd373eacd33b4186ba9358
spent
true